Section 45 Sheriffs and Civil Process Act
Section 45 of the Sheriffs and Civil Process Act 1945 is about Levy of execution upon materials used in construction of a building. It provides as follows:
Where the judgment debtor is a citizen of Nigeria, and the property attached is the right, title or interest of the judgment debtor in a building owned or occupied by the judgment debtor, which building or the right to occupy the building the judgment debtor is not entitled under customary law to alienate, but the materials or some of the materials used in construction thereof the judgment debtor is entitled to remove, the right, title or interest of the judgment debtor in such building shall not be sold without the leave of the court first obtained, which leave may, at the discretion of the court, be refused or granted with or without conditions attached.
